Wird 12.04 wie 11.10 standardmäßig in Unity verwendet?


10

Als ich von 11.04 auf 11.10 aktualisiert habe, wurde ich beim ersten Start in die Unity-Shell eingefügt. Seitdem habe ich mich jedoch für Gnome-Classic entschieden.

Meine Frage ist, wenn Ubuntu 12.04 im nächsten April herauskommt, wird es dasselbe tun und standardmäßig die Unity-Shell verwenden, und ich muss Gnome und Gnome-classic neu installieren? Oder bleiben meine Gnome-Classic-Oberfläche und -Einstellungen erhalten?


1
Ja, es gibt eine Gnome-Fallback-Sitzung für die Gnome-Shell, wenn Sie diese installieren. Wenn Sie dies nicht tun, ist Uunity 2D Ihre andere Option. Es gibt keinen Gnome-Klassiker alias Gnome 2 in 11.10 und wird auch nicht in 12.04 sein und Sie können ihn nicht installieren, ohne Ihr System zu bremsen.
Uri Herrera

2
@UriHerrera: Ich denke, Sie könnten sich irren, was die Frage stellt. Außerdem führe ich Gnome-Classic gerade auf 11.10 aus, daher denke ich, dass Sie Gnome2 und Gnome-Classic verwechseln, die verschiedene Dinge sind.
Frager

Ja, hab es jetzt.
Uri Herrera

Antworten:


15

Ihre GNOME Classic-Oberfläche (dh Fallback) und Ihre diesbezüglichen Einstellungen bleiben mit ziemlicher Sicherheit erhalten, wenn Sie ein Upgrade von Ubuntu 11.10 auf Ubuntu 12.04 LTS durchführen.

Ubuntu 11.04 verwendete GTK + 2 und GNOME 2. Standardmäßig wurden drei Sitzungstypen bereitgestellt: Ubuntu(GNOME 2 mit der GTK + 2-Version von Unity, für die eine 3D-Beschleunigung erforderlich war), Ubuntu Classic(eine klassische GNOME 2-Schnittstelle) und Ubuntu Classic (no effects)(dasselbe, aber überhaupt keine visuellen Effekte).

Beim Upgrade von Ubuntu 11.04 Natty Narwhal auf Ubuntu 11.10 Oneiric Ocelot wurde GTK + 2 durch GTK + 3 ersetzt. Die Unity-Oberfläche gab es für GTK + 3, und obwohl sie sich "unter der Haube" (aus diesem und anderen Gründen) stark verändert hat, hat sich die Benutzererfahrung nur geringfügig geändert. Die klassische GNOME 2-Schnittstelle erfordert jedoch GTK + 2. Daher wurde es durch Unity 2D ersetzt, das sich sehr ähnlich wie Unity und sehr wenig wie die klassische GNOME 2-Oberfläche verhält.

Wie Sie wissen (seit Sie es verwenden), ein GNOME Classic-Sitzungstyp (der die GNOME Fallback-Schnittstelle bereitstellt, eine GNOME 3-Schnittstelle mit einer Shell, die sich sehr ähnlich anfühlt, aber keineswegs mit der alten Shell von GNOME 2 identisch ist ) ist in Ubuntu 11.10 verfügbar. Es wird vom gnome-session-fallbackPaket bereitgestellt. Der Sitzungstyp GNOME Classic ist keine logische Fortsetzung einer früheren Schnittstelle, die in früheren Ubuntu-Versionen vorhanden war, und wird eher von der Community als von Canonical unterstützt (dh er wird in der Universe- Komponente und nicht in der Hauptkomponente bereitgestellt ). . Aus diesen Gründen wäre es nicht sinnvoll, es während einer Neuinstallation oder eines Upgrades standardmäßig zu installieren, und dies ist nicht der Fall. Sie mussten es selbst installieren (indem Sie dem Paketmanager mitteilten, dass Sie das eine bestimmte Paket möchten).

Es gibt keine Pläne, gnome-session-fallbackUbuntu 12.04 LTS Precise Pangolin zu entfernen. Wenn Sie also den GNOME ClassicSitzungstyp in Ubuntu 11.10 verwenden, besteht kein Grund zu der Annahme, dass Sie ihn auch in Ubuntu 12.04 LTS nicht verwenden können. Derzeit befindet sich diese Version im Alpha-Test. gnome-session-fallbackkann in Precise-Systemen installiert werden. Wenn ein Oneiric-System installiert ist, bleibt es beim Upgrade auf Precise alpha installiert. Wenn dies GNOME Classicder Standard-Sitzungstyp in einem Oneiric-System ist (entweder global oder für einen Benutzer), bleibt dies auch dann der Fall, wenn dieses System auf Precise Alpha aktualisiert wird.

Wenn Sie ein Upgrade von einer Version auf eine andere durchführen, sollten Sie damit rechnen, dass sich das Erscheinungsbild und das Verhalten der meisten Anwendungen ändern. In GNOME ClassicSitzungen wird wahrscheinlich Änderungen an der GNOME-Fallback-Oberfläche vorgenommen . Es ist jedoch unwahrscheinlich, dass die Änderungen sehr groß sind, da dies als Fallback-Schnittstelle konzipiert ist. Es ist nicht dort, wo eine Blutungsentwicklung auftritt. Diese Änderungen sind möglicherweise nicht einmal spürbar. Unabhängig davon, ob dies der Fall ist oder nicht, sollten Ihre Einstellungen in dieser Benutzeroberfläche (z. B. das Layout, das Sie für Ihre Panels verwenden) beim Upgrade auf Ubuntu 12.04 LTS unverändert bleiben.

Da noch einige Zeit verbleibt, bis Ubuntu 12.04 LTS herauskommt, ist es natürlich möglich, dass größere Änderungen vorgenommen werden. Insbesondere angesichts der Tatsache, dass es sich um eine LTS-Version handelt, bei der die Stabilität und langfristige Benutzerfreundlichkeit im Vordergrund stehen, anstatt größere Änderungen vorzunehmen oder große neue Funktionen einzuführen, ist es unwahrscheinlich, dass eine der aktuellen Schnittstellen enorm geändert oder hergestellt wird nicht verfügbar.


1
Vielen Dank für diese vollständige Antwort. Das macht Sinn. Also ... wenn ich dich richtig verstehe, sollte ich Gnome Classic, das es vorher nicht gab, behalten können. Mir wurde nur Unity angeboten, weil der Schiefer sozusagen bis zu den Muscheln sauber gewischt wurde. Außerdem verstehe ich, dass es geringfügige Unterschiede geben wird. Ich möchte einfach keine völlig neue Hülle erhalten. (Wenn alle Ubuntu / Gnome - Entwickler da draußen sind , lassen Sie uns nicht Gnome-Classic - Fans hängen;))
Frager

Ja das ist richtig. Obwohl Oli eigentlich einen guten Grund hat, über die Änderung der Standard-DM zu sprechen . Dies wäre wahrscheinlich separat ausreichend gewesen, um die Standard-Sitzungstypen aller Benutzer (und die globalen) zurückzusetzen, da die GDM-Einstellungen beim Upgrade von Natty auf Oneiric leider nicht in LightDM importiert wurden. (Dies ändert nichts an der Antwort, aber ich möchte Oli dafür danken, dass er diesen Punkt erwähnt hat.) Auch ohne das wäre es zurückgesetzt worden, weil Oneiric kein Äquivalent von hat Ubuntu Classic. Beides wird voraussichtlich nicht von Oneiric bis Precise passieren.
Eliah Kagan

4

Es ist nahezu unmöglich, genau zu sagen, was an diesem Punkt passieren wird, aber ich kann Folgendes sagen:

Der Grund, warum Sie beim Upgrade standardmäßig Unity verwendet haben, ist, dass LighDM GDM ersetzt hat und der eigentliche gnome-classicDesktop nicht mehr vorhanden ist ( gnome-session-fallbackjetzt). Alles änderte seinen Namen und Gnome Shell (von der gnome-session-fallbackein Teil ist) war keine Standardinstallationsoption.

Diese Art von massiven Änderungen bedeutet, dass Sie beim Upgrade-Vorgang die Standardeinstellungen beibehalten. Es hätte klüger sein können, aber es war nicht so.

Angesichts der Tatsache, dass die Dinge in Bezug auf Nomenklatur und Stapel wahrscheinlich ziemlich statisch bleiben, sehe ich keinen guten Grund, warum Sie Ihre Standardeinstellungen wieder verlieren würden.

Aber es ist früh und Canonical wirft gerne Dinge in letzter Minute ein.


Update 04.04.12: Ich freue mich, Ihnen mitteilen zu können, dass ich durch das Upgrade von Gnome Classic in 11.10 auf 12.04 Beta 2 meine Standard-Desktop-Installation erhalten habe.

Ich verlasse meinen ersten Beitrag oben, weil er hervorhebt, wo die Probleme in früheren Versionen aufgetreten sind.


0

In 12.04 wird Unity weiterhin der Standard-Desktop sein. Wie Sie dies jetzt tun können, können Sie Gnome Shell installieren oder neu installieren. Im Fallback-Modus bleiben Ihre Einstellungen danach erhalten.


Es tut mir leid, aber Sie sprechen immer noch über Gnome2, was nichts mit dem zu tun hat, worüber ich frage. Ich frage auch nicht nach einem "Fallback-Modus". Ich danke Ihnen, dass Sie sich die Zeit genommen haben, um zu antworten, aber leider denke ich, dass Sie sich auf einem völlig anderen Weg befinden.
Frager

2
Die Gnome-Classic-Sitzung ist der Gnome-Shelll-Fallback-Modus <- vollständiger Name.
Uri Herrera

Wie Sie hier sehen können: askubuntu.com/questions/69576/…
Uri Herrera

2
Der Befehl installiert ein Paket, gnome-session-fallbackdas in LightDM den Namen Gnome-Classic trägt.
Uri Herrera

Ähm ... nein. Das glaube ich nicht. Weil es nicht "zurückfällt", wenn andere Optionen nicht funktionieren. Es emuliert die Gnome2-Schnittstelle, jedoch mit Gnome3-Code. Auf jeden Fall beantworten Sie die Frage nicht. Vielen Dank für Ihre Zeit, aber ich werde auf andere Antworten warten.
Frager

0

Ich habe 12.04 Alpha 1 seit ungefähr 2 Wochen ausgeführt und Gnome ausgeführt.

  1. Gnom - viele raffinierte bewegliche Teile, etwas schuppig, funktioniert aber gut.
  2. Gnome Classic. Ein bisschen ähnlich wie Unity, aber mit dem unteren Bereich können Sie sehen, welche Fenster geöffnet sind.
  3. Gnome Classic ohne Effekte. Ziemlich genau wie Gnome Classic in 11.10

Alle arbeiten sehr glücklich in 12.04.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.